A good workman always cleans up after himself so..The following will implement some cleanup procedures as well as reset  System Restore points:


Click Start > Run  and copy/paste the following bolded text into the Run box and click OK:

ComboFix /Uninstall

Run OTS and hit the cleanup button.  It will remove all the programmes we have used plus itself. 

We will now confirm that your hidden files are set to that, as some of the tools I use will change that
  • Click Start.
  • Open My Computer.
  • Select the Tools menu and click Folder Options.
  • Select the View Tab.
  • Under the Hidden files and folders heading select Do not show hidden files and folders.
  • Click Yes to confirm.
  • Click OK.

In the meantime, here are a few suggestions in addition to the ones given to you by Essexboy to keep you and your machine safer in the future:

1.   Keep your definitions up to date for both Avast and MBAM. 
2.   Keep all your shields on with Avast.
3.   Update MBAM prior to scanning, then do Quick scans.
4.   Keep your MS/Windows Updates current.
5.   Add security related Add-on’s to your browsers for safer browsing.  See my Signature as an example.
6.   Use common sense when browsing and do not go to risky sites.
7.   When downloading software, read what you are clicking and do not download adware toolbars which are commonly opted in; look before you click or do a Custom install to avoid putting unwanted toolbars on your machine that lead to spyware tracking or adware.
8.   Check to see that your software is up to date with the free Secunia Software Inspector http://secunia.com/vulnerability_scanning/personal/ since software is changing all the time.  This site gives you the vendor's direct download link making it easy to upgrade your software.  Many of us here scan our machines weekly.
